Transaction 80e22777979572332d131c660947e5db9d3e4983beec788067201bfcc5bfe831
1 Input
1 Output
-
80e22777979572332d131c660947e5db9d3e4983beec788067201bfcc5bfe831:0
- value
- 49958498
- script pubkey
- OP_0 OP_PUSHBYTES_20 2df945c24a64f02db6e859313b810ffa3e9500bf
- address
- bc1q9hu5tsj2vnczmdhgtycnhqg0lglf2q9l73x9ad